Silica gel is a desiccant, a substance that absorbs moisture. Desiccants can be dried and reused by heating to remove absorbed moisture. The shelf life of desiccants is determined by the packaging environment in which they are used, but most desiccants have a shelf life of one to three years and can be reused upon regenerating them.
